Installation of the 2 Offshore Substations (J-Tubes, TP’s and Topsides) of the Baltic Power Windfarm

Market: Renewables

Scope of Work: Installation of the 2 Offshore Substations (J-Tubes, TP’s and Topsides) of the Baltic Power Windfarm

Location: Polish sector in the Baltic Sea

Client: CS WIND Offshore A/S

Period: October 2025

HLV: Gulliver

 

Baltic Power is the first offshore wind farm to be constructed in Polish waters, it is located in the Polish Exclusive Economic Zone (EEZ) in the Baltic Sea, approximately 23 km from the coastline. The wind farm comprises 76 wind turbines with a total production capacity of nearly 1.2 GW. The turbines are connected to two offshore substations, located in the East and West of the site respectively.

CS WIND Offshore, former Bladt Industries, is fabricator of all OSS structures and has awarded Scaldis with the transport & installation scope of all OSS structures (except the monopiles).

Despite the timing (autumn season), the Baltic once more proved to be a good match with HLV Gulliver in terms of workability, in particular for the very challenging alignment of 2 flanges during TP installation. Overall the offshore campaign for installation of the 2 substations was completed in only 10 days.

Scaldis Scope:

The T&I scope comprised following tasks:

  • Transport of OSS structures
  • Provision of 2 barges and respective lead tugs for the transport from fabricator yard (Aalborg) to Baltic Power construction site
  • Installation of OSS structures, for each OSS location:
    • Monopile cleaning
    • J-tube installation (lower & upper section), including Piranha clamp connection (earthing)
    • TP installation, including bolting of MP-TP flange connection (tensioning of 144pc M80 bolts)
    • Topside installation

All offshore operations were executed on DP
